Building Packing Light Outfits That Work Across Settings

The foundation of strong packing light outfits begins with versatile silhouettes. Tailored wide-leg trousers, a structured tank, a relaxed button-down, and a lightweight blazer create a framework that moves easily from daytime exploring to evening reservations. Each piece should layer naturally with the others. When garments share complementary tones and clean lines, combinations multiply quickly. This structure allows you to restyle instead of re-wear in obvious ways.

Creating Range Through Proportion and Styling

Outfits feel repetitive when they are styled the same way each time. Shifting proportions instantly changes perception. Wear trousers loose with an untucked shirt and flats for a relaxed morning, then define the waist, add a sharper shoe, and introduce jewellery for evening. Rolling sleeves, half-tucking, belting, or layering alters balance. These small adjustments give depth to your wardrobe without adding a single extra item to your suitcase.

Choosing Fabrics That Travel Well

Fabric choice determines whether packing light feels polished or careless. Structured cotton, lightweight wool blends, and quality linen with body hold their shape after hours folded away. Avoid overly delicate or wrinkle-prone materials that demand maintenance. Texture is equally important. Combining smooth fabrics with subtle structure creates visual interest, making simple combinations look intentional rather than plain. Good fabric selection quietly elevates everything.

Using Colour Strategy to Avoid Repetition

A controlled colour palette is one of the strongest tools in travel styling. Neutrals such as ivory, black, sand, navy, or muted olive blend seamlessly and allow pieces to rotate effortlessly. Introducing one accent shade across two items creates cohesion without overpowering the wardrobe. When colours relate naturally, you can mix freely while maintaining consistency. The eye reads harmony, not repetition.

How Packing Light Outfits Stay Visually Fresh

Packing light outfits remain visually fresh when you think in layers rather than full looks. An oversized shirt can be worn open over a tank, buttoned and tucked into trousers, or draped over shoulders. A blazer can sharpen casual pieces or replace outerwear in cooler evenings. Even subtle contrasts in texture or sleeve length change the mood. Adaptability is what keeps a compact wardrobe dynamic.

Footwear and Accessories That Do the Work

Shoes influence the tone of an outfit more than most travellers realise. A sleek sneaker signals ease, while a refined sandal or low heel introduces polish. Limiting yourself to two or three pairs that coordinate with every garment prevents overpacking while maintaining range. Accessories further shift the mood. A silk scarf, minimal gold jewellery, or a structured belt adds variation without consuming space.
